This church has characteristic elements of the Romaneque Auvergnate period, it's chapel is made up of 3 radiant chapels. Inside, the choir is surrounded by a corridor called an ambulatory which is rarely found in the Combrailles.
A string of billets (rectangular-shaped decoration) runs above the bays. Numerous sculpted modillions under the roof complete the exterior decoration of this chevet. All the pillars of the ambulatory have sculpted capitals, one of which has the theme of avarice and another that of minotaurs.
